Italy’s World Cup Women’s Soccer Team Suffers Devastating Own Goal
In a shocking turn of events, Benedetta Orsi of Italy’s World Cup women’s soccer team made a critical mistake that led to her own team’s downfall. During a match against South Africa, Orsi’s intended pass to Italy’s goalkeeper ended up rolling into her own team’s net, giving the South African team a much-needed boost. This unfortunate blunder ultimately resulted in Italy’s elimination from the World Cup with a 3-2 defeat.
The incident occurred when Italy’s Elena Linari passed the ball to Orsi, who was being lightly guarded by a South African player. Orsi, without checking her surroundings, attempted to kick the ball back to goalkeeper Francesca Durante. However, Durante was not in position to receive the pass, and the ball ended up entering the net, leading to a South African goal. The moment was captured in a video that quickly went viral, immortalizing Orsi’s own goal.

Italy managed to regain the lead with a goal from Arianna Caruso, but South Africa fought back with two more goals from Hildah Magaia and Thembi Kgatlana, securing their victory and eliminating Italy from the World Cup. Despite Italy’s higher ranking (16th) compared to South Africa (54th) according to FIFA, the South African team proved their skill and emerged triumphant.
The mistake made by Orsi quickly became a topic of discussion on social media, with many users sharing their reactions and opinions.

Italy’s coach, Milena Bertolini, admitted that South Africa played better and deserved the win. The defeat left Italy’s players stunned and at a loss for words.
“I really don’t know,” Durante said after the match. “I don’t know what didn’t work.”
“I don’t think I can find the right words in this moment,” Caruso added. “I am not happy because we scored two goals, and we didn’t do anything.”
Italy’s journey in the Women’s World Cup came to an end due to this unfortunate own goal, leaving them with a bitter taste of defeat.
